Saeid Safaei Loader Logo Saeid Safaei Loader Animated
لطفا شکیبا باشید
0

سعیدصفایی سعیدصفایی

سعید صفایی
آشنایی با مفهوم توپولوژی ترکیبی (Hybrid Topology)

توپولوژی ترکیبی (Hybrid Topology)

از ادغام دو یا چند توپولوژی شبکه متفاوت با یکدیگر توپولوژی ترکیبی به وجود می‌آید.

Saeid Safaei توپولوژی ترکیبی (Hybrid Topology)

مقدمه‌ای بر توپولوژی ترکیبی (Hybrid Topology)

توپولوژی ترکیبی (Hybrid Topology) به نوعی از شبکه گفته می‌شود که از ترکیب دو یا چند توپولوژی مختلف شبکه تشکیل شده است. این نوع توپولوژی به دلیل ترکیب ویژگی‌های مثبت توپولوژی‌های مختلف، برای شبکه‌های بزرگ و پیچیده مناسب است. توپولوژی ترکیبی می‌تواند به سازمان‌ها این امکان را بدهد که از مزایای چندین توپولوژی مختلف بهره‌برداری کنند و در عین حال مشکلات و محدودیت‌های هر کدام را کاهش دهند. در این مقاله، به بررسی مفهوم توپولوژی ترکیبی، مزایا، معایب، کاربردها و نحوه پیاده‌سازی آن خواهیم پرداخت.

تعریف توپولوژی ترکیبی (Hybrid Topology)

توپولوژی ترکیبی به شبکه‌ای اطلاق می‌شود که از ترکیب دو یا چند توپولوژی مختلف برای برقراری ارتباطات بین دستگاه‌ها استفاده می‌کند. به عبارت دیگر، در توپولوژی ترکیبی، اجزای مختلف شبکه می‌توانند از توپولوژی‌های متفاوتی مانند ستاره‌ای، حلقوی، مش یا خطی برای ارتباط استفاده کنند. این توپولوژی معمولاً در شبکه‌های بزرگ و پیچیده که نیاز به انعطاف‌پذیری بالا و مقیاس‌پذیری دارند، به کار می‌رود.

ویژگی‌های توپولوژی ترکیبی

توپولوژی ترکیبی دارای ویژگی‌هایی است که آن را برای شبکه‌های بزرگ و پیچیده مناسب می‌سازد. برخی از ویژگی‌های این توپولوژی عبارتند از:

  • انعطاف‌پذیری: توپولوژی ترکیبی به شما این امکان را می‌دهد که از ویژگی‌های مثبت چندین توپولوژی مختلف بهره‌برداری کنید و ساختار شبکه را بر اساس نیازهای خاص خود طراحی کنید.
  • مقیاس‌پذیری بالا: این توپولوژی می‌تواند به راحتی گسترش یابد و به شبکه‌های بزرگ‌تر و پیچیده‌تر تبدیل شود.
  • ترکیب مزایای توپولوژی‌های مختلف: توپولوژی ترکیبی این امکان را فراهم می‌آورد که از مزایای هر توپولوژی (مانند پایداری، سرعت، و امنیت) بهره‌برداری کنید و در عین حال معایب آن‌ها را کاهش دهید.

مزایا و معایب توپولوژی ترکیبی

توپولوژی ترکیبی مزایا و معایب خاص خود را دارد که بسته به نیاز شبکه و نوع کاربرد آن می‌تواند مناسب یا غیرمناسب باشد. در این بخش، به برخی از مزایا و معایب این توپولوژی پرداخته‌ایم:

  • مزایا:
    • انعطاف‌پذیری بالا: این توپولوژی به شما این امکان را می‌دهد که بسته به نیازهای خاص شبکه، از توپولوژی‌های مختلف استفاده کنید و به راحتی تغییرات ایجاد کنید.
    • مقیاس‌پذیری: توپولوژی ترکیبی می‌تواند به راحتی گسترش یابد و از نظر ظرفیت و عملکرد به شبکه‌های بزرگتر و پیچیده‌تر تبدیل شود.
    • مناسب برای شبکه‌های بزرگ: این توپولوژی برای شبکه‌های بزرگ و پیچیده که نیاز به ساختارهای متنوع دارند، بسیار مناسب است.
  • معایب:
    • هزینه بالا: پیاده‌سازی توپولوژی ترکیبی به دلیل نیاز به تجهیزات متنوع و طراحی پیچیده‌تر ممکن است هزینه‌بر باشد.
    • پیچیدگی در مدیریت: شبکه‌هایی که از توپولوژی ترکیبی استفاده می‌کنند، ممکن است پیچیدگی‌های بیشتری در نگهداری، مدیریت و عیب‌یابی داشته باشند.
    • نیاز به تخصص بالا: طراحی و پیاده‌سازی توپولوژی ترکیبی نیاز به تخصص بالایی دارد و ممکن است برای برخی سازمان‌ها چالش‌برانگیز باشد.

انواع توپولوژی‌های ترکیبی

توپولوژی ترکیبی می‌تواند از ترکیب انواع مختلف توپولوژی‌های شبکه ایجاد شود. برخی از رایج‌ترین انواع توپولوژی‌های ترکیبی عبارتند از:

  • ترکیب توپولوژی ستاره‌ای و حلقوی: در این نوع ترکیب، دستگاه‌ها به صورت ستاره‌ای به یک سوئیچ یا روتر مرکزی متصل می‌شوند و سپس از یک حلقه برای ارتباطات داخلی بین برخی از دستگاه‌ها استفاده می‌شود.
  • ترکیب توپولوژی ستاره‌ای و مش: در این نوع توپولوژی ترکیبی، دستگاه‌ها به صورت ستاره‌ای به یک دستگاه مرکزی متصل می‌شوند، اما برای انتقال داده‌ها از اتصالات مش بین دستگاه‌ها استفاده می‌شود.
  • ترکیب توپولوژی خطی و ستاره‌ای: در این ترکیب، شبکه‌ای که به صورت خطی طراحی شده است، به یک دستگاه مرکزی به صورت ستاره‌ای متصل می‌شود تا مزایای هر دو توپولوژی را داشته باشد.

کاربردهای توپولوژی ترکیبی

توپولوژی ترکیبی در بسیاری از شبکه‌های بزرگ و پیچیده کاربرد دارد. این توپولوژی برای شبکه‌هایی که نیاز به ترکیب ویژگی‌های مختلف توپولوژی‌ها دارند، مناسب است. برخی از کاربردهای رایج این توپولوژی عبارتند از:

  • شبکه‌های سازمانی بزرگ: در سازمان‌های بزرگ، توپولوژی ترکیبی می‌تواند برای پیاده‌سازی شبکه‌های پیچیده و نیازمند به مقیاس‌پذیری و امنیت بالا استفاده شود.
  • شبکه‌های تجاری و صنعتی: در صنایع و کسب‌وکارهای بزرگ که نیاز به ارتباطات سریع و امن دارند، از توپولوژی ترکیبی برای بهبود عملکرد و کاهش هزینه‌ها استفاده می‌شود.
  • دیتاسنترها: در دیتاسنترهای بزرگ و پیچیده، توپولوژی ترکیبی می‌تواند برای اتصال سرورها و دستگاه‌ها به یکدیگر به کار رود تا عملکرد شبکه بهینه شود.

نتیجه‌گیری

توپولوژی ترکیبی (Hybrid Topology) به دلیل قابلیت‌های بالای انعطاف‌پذیری و مقیاس‌پذیری خود، برای شبکه‌های بزرگ و پیچیده بسیار مناسب است. این توپولوژی به سازمان‌ها این امکان را می‌دهد که از مزایای چندین توپولوژی مختلف بهره‌برداری کنند و در عین حال مشکلات هر کدام را کاهش دهند. با این حال، هزینه بالای پیاده‌سازی و پیچیدگی در مدیریت آن می‌تواند از معایب این توپولوژی باشد. برای اطلاعات بیشتر در این زمینه، می‌توانید از منابع موجود در سایت saeidsafaei.ir و اسلایدهای محمد سعید صفایی بهره‌برداری کنید.

اسلاید آموزشی

مقدمه و معماری شبکه

مقدمه و معماری شبکه
شبکه های کامپیوتری

در این جلسه، مفاهیم پایه‌ای شبکه‌های کامپیوتری معرفی شده و انواع شبکه‌ها از نظر گستردگی و مسافت مانند LAN، WAN و MAN بررسی می‌شوند. همچنین، معماری‌های شبکه شامل کلاینت-سرور و نظیر به نظیر مورد بحث قرار گرفته و رایج‌ترین توپولوژی‌های شبکه مانند ستاره‌ای، خطی، حلقوی و مش توضیح داده می‌شوند. هدف این جلسه، آشنایی با ساختار کلی شبکه‌ها و درک نحوه ارتباط و سازمان‌دهی اجزای مختلف آن‌ها است.

مقالات آموزشی برای آشنایی با اصطلاحات دنیای کامپیوتر

تکنولوژی دفترکل توزیع‌شده (DLT) به فناوری‌های بلاکچین و سایر شبکه‌های غیرمتمرکز برای ذخیره‌سازی و مدیریت داده‌ها اشاره دارد.

پروتکل مسیریابی Distance Vector که به روترها کمک می‌کند تا مسیرهای بهترین را بر اساس تعداد هاپ‌ها پیدا کنند.

روش مکمل دو برای نشان دادن اعداد منفی در سیستم‌های دودویی است که با معکوس کردن بیت‌ها و اضافه کردن یک انجام می‌شود.

محاسبات عصبی‌شکل به محاسباتی گفته می‌شود که مدل‌سازی مغز انسان را تقلید می‌کند تا راه‌حل‌هایی مشابه سیستم‌های عصبی طبیعی ایجاد کند.

کد شیء به کدی اطلاق می‌شود که پس از ترجمه توسط کامپایلر از کد منبع به زبان ماشین تبدیل شده است. این کد آماده اجرا است.

هوش افزوده به تقویت توانمندی‌های انسانی از طریق تکنولوژی‌های هوش مصنوعی گفته می‌شود تا تصمیم‌گیری‌های بهتری صورت گیرد.

دستگاه‌های متصل به شبکه که داده‌ها را ارسال یا دریافت می‌کنند، مانند کامپیوترها، سرورها، یا سایر تجهیزات شبکه.

انتقال سبک عصبی یک تکنیک یادگیری ماشین است که برای اعمال سبک هنری به تصاویر استفاده می‌شود.

شبکه‌های خودترمیمی به شبکه‌هایی اطلاق می‌شود که قادر به شناسایی و اصلاح خطاها یا مشکلات خود به‌طور خودکار هستند.

ربات‌های جمعی به استفاده از ربات‌ها برای انجام کارهای گروهی اشاره دارند که در آن‌ها ربات‌ها با همکاری یکدیگر وظایف را انجام می‌دهند.

پایگاه‌های داده گراف به پایگاه‌های داده‌ای اطلاق می‌شود که برای ذخیره و مدیریت اطلاعات در قالب گراف‌ها طراحی شده‌اند.

رایانه‌های کوانتومی از اصول فیزیک کوانتومی برای حل مسائل پیچیده‌ای که برای رایانه‌های سنتی غیرممکن هستند استفاده می‌کنند.

امنیت سایبری به مجموعه‌ای از روش‌ها و تکنیک‌ها اطلاق می‌شود که برای محافظت از سیستم‌ها، شبکه‌ها و داده‌ها در برابر تهدیدات دیجیتال به کار می‌روند.

گراف جهت‌دار گرافی است که در آن یال‌ها جهت‌دار هستند و از یک گره به گره دیگر اشاره دارند.

نگهداری پیش‌بینی به استفاده از داده‌ها و الگوریتم‌ها برای پیش‌بینی زمان‌بندی تعمیرات و پیشگیری از خرابی‌های احتمالی اشاره دارد.

پروتکلی که برای ارتباطات بی‌سیم در شبکه‌های LAN استفاده می‌شود.

یک ترابایت معادل 1024 گیگابایت است و برای اندازه‌گیری حجم‌های بسیار زیاد داده‌ها استفاده می‌شود.

درخت دودویی نوعی درخت است که در هر گره آن حداکثر دو فرزند وجود دارد.

حلقه while به طور مکرر یک دستور را اجرا می‌کند تا زمانی که شرط خاصی برقرار باشد. این حلقه برای مواقعی که تعداد تکرار مشخص نیست، مناسب است.

امنیت نوع به توانایی یک زبان برنامه‌نویسی برای جلوگیری از ارورهایی اطلاق می‌شود که ناشی از تعاملات ناسازگار میان انواع داده‌ها هستند.

آرایه دو بعدی آرایه‌ای است که از سطرها و ستون‌ها تشکیل شده و برای ذخیره داده‌هایی مانند جدول‌ها استفاده می‌شود.

لایه‌ای که مسئول ترجمه، رمزنگاری و فشرده‌سازی داده‌ها برای استفاده در لایه کاربرد است.

عملگرهای منطقی برای مقایسه و ارزیابی عبارات منطقی استفاده می‌شوند و می‌توانند نتیجه‌ای درست یا غلط را تولید کنند.

شبکه‌های مولد رقابتی (GANs) دو شبکه عصبی را برای تولید داده‌های جدید از داده‌های واقعی به کار می‌گیرد.

حلقه do-while مشابه با while است، با این تفاوت که ابتدا دستورالعمل‌ها اجرا می‌شود و سپس شرط بررسی می‌شود. بنابراین این حلقه حداقل یک بار اجرا می‌شود.

تابع اصلی در برنامه‌های C++ است که برنامه از آن شروع به اجرا می‌کند. این تابع به طور معمول به صورت int main تعریف می‌شود.

این تکنیک در علم داده و تحلیل داده‌ها به معنای جمع‌آوری و تجزیه و تحلیل داده‌ها به گونه‌ای است که از انتشار اطلاعات شخصی جلوگیری شود و همزمان از داده‌ها برای استخراج الگوهای عمومی استفاده شود.

پایگاه داده مجموعه‌ای از داده‌های ذخیره‌شده به صورت ساختارمند است که به راحتی می‌توان به آن‌ها دسترسی داشت و از آن‌ها استفاده کرد.

شبکه‌های مجازی‌شده به شبکه‌هایی اطلاق می‌شود که از فناوری مجازی‌سازی برای ایجاد و مدیریت منابع شبکه استفاده می‌کنند.

پهنای باند به میزان داده‌هایی اطلاق می‌شود که در یک واحد زمانی بین سیستم‌ها یا اجزای مختلف سیستم منتقل می‌شود.

پورت‌هایی که برای انتقال ترافیک مربوط به چندین VLAN بین سوئیچ‌ها استفاده می‌شوند.

پورت‌هایی که به دلیل جلوگیری از ایجاد حلقه‌های شبکه غیرفعال شده‌اند.

سلسله مراتب حافظه به توزیع انواع مختلف حافظه بر اساس اندازه، سرعت دسترسی و هزینه مربوط می‌شود. در این سلسله مراتب، حافظه‌های سریع‌تر و گران‌تر در نزدیک‌ترین سطح به پردازنده قرار دارند، مانند ثبات‌ها (Registers)، حافظه نهان (Cache)، و سپس حافظه اصلی (RAM).

هوش مصنوعی لبه (Edge AI) استفاده از مدل‌های یادگیری ماشین و پردازش داده‌ها را در دستگاه‌های لبه شبکه (نزدیک به کاربر) تسهیل می‌کند.

مدل استاندارد شبکه‌ای که ارتباطات سیستم‌های مختلف را در 7 لایه مجزا تنظیم می‌کند. هر لایه وظایف خاص خود را دارد و با لایه‌های مجاور خود ارتباط برقرار می‌کند.

بکشید مشاهده بستن پخش
Saeid Safaei Scroll Top
0%